Extreme Weather Events Ravage Continent

Europe is being ravaged by a series of devastating floods and record-breaking heatwaves, causing widespread destruction and disruption in popular holiday destinations.

In Germany, severe flooding has claimed over 180 lives, while in Belgium, at least 27 people have died. Heavy rainfall has led to swollen rivers overflowing their banks, inundating towns and villages.

Simultaneously, a heatwave has gripped southern Europe, with temperatures soaring above 40 degrees Celsius (104 degrees Fahrenheit) in Italy, Spain, and Greece. Wildfires have erupted in several areas, exacerbating the crisis.

The extreme weather conditions have disrupted transportation, closed businesses, and forced thousands of people to evacuate their homes. Holidaymakers have been stranded as flights and train services have been canceled.

Experts warn that climate change is contributing to the increased frequency and intensity of such extreme weather events. They urge immediate action to mitigate the effects and prevent future disasters.
